How much do alarm monitoring j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 27, 2026, the average hourly pay for alarm monitoring in Michigan is $19.36,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.91 and $21.78 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Alarm Monitoring vs Security Guard?

AspectAlarm MonitoringSecurity Guard
CredentialsTypically requires monitoring certifications, security licensesSecurity guard license, sometimes additional training
Work EnvironmentControl rooms, remote monitoring centersOn-site at client locations, patrols
Employer & IndustrySecurity companies, alarm service providersSecurity firms, private security services
Primary RoleMonitor alarms, respond to alerts remotelyPatrol, observe, prevent security incidents

Alarm Monitoring involves remotely overseeing security systems and responding to alerts, while Security Guards are on-site personnel who physically patrol and observe to prevent incidents. Both roles are essential in security but differ in work environment and responsibilities.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als working in alarm monitoring centers?

Alarm monitoring professionals often face challenges such as managing high-stress situations, responding quickly and accurately to multiple simultaneous alarms, and maintaining focus during long or overnight shifts. The role requires excellent attention to detail and strong communication skills, as team members must coordinate closely with emergency responders and clients. Adapting to evolving security technologies and staying updated on protocols is also essential for success in this dynamic environment.

What is alarm monitoring?

Alarm monitoring is a security service where signals from alarm systems, such as burglar or fire alarms, are transmitted to a central monitoring station. At this station, trained professionals respond to alerts by quickly assessing the situation and contacting the appropriate emergency services if necessary. This service provides round-the-clock surveillance and peace of mind by ensuring that any potential security breaches or emergencies are addressed promptly. Alarm monitoring can be used for homes, businesses, and other properties to enhance safety and protection.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Alarm Monitoring Specialist,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Alarm Monitoring Specialist, you need strong attention to detail, the ability to quickly assess emergency situations, and typically a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with alarm monitoring software, security system panels, and communication tools like two-way radios is often required. Excellent communication, problem-solving skills, and the ability to remain calm under pressure are crucial soft skills in this role. These skills ensure timely and accurate responses to alarms, safeguarding property and lives in emergency situations.
